Best Times to Visit Saint-Jean-le-Comtal

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

Choosing the optimal time to visit this destination ensures you experience its natural beauty and local charm at their best, making your stay here truly unforgettable.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the summer months, this destination experiences warm weather that is perfect for exploring the scenic countryside and enjoying outdoor activities.

Average Temperature Daytime: 25°C - 30°C - Nighttime: 15°C - 18°C
autumn
Early Fall (September to October)

As the region transitions into autumn, you can appreciate the pleasant climate and vibrant landscapes, making it an ideal time for sightseeing and local festivities.

Average Temperature Daytime: 20°C - 25°C - Nighttime: 10°C - 13°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Late Fall to Winter (November to February)

During these cooler months, the area offers a quieter experience with fewer visitors, providing a peaceful retreat in cozy accommodations.

Average Temperature Daytime: 8°C - 12°C - Nighttime: 2°C - 5°C
image
Early Spring (March to May)

In early spring, the region begins to awaken with milder weather and blooming scenery, ideal for those seeking an off-peak escape with fewer crowds.

Average Temperature Daytime: 12°C - 17°C - Nighttime: 4°C - 8°C
